Transaction 74f5c3ca1cfe76a693e4059c636a30056648a6d487ec5dc706681c613e45aee9

block
1533e16531d1eca8a5d5a99aeaabb541f0f105d83061844c4570a602c559ccaa

22 Inputs

2 Outputs